All posts in " sleepy hollow s01e13 "

Sleepy Hollow – Season 01, Episode 13

By Ishrar / 9 years ago

By: Kh Ishrar Bad Blood Ichabod, Abbie and Jenny gather and wait for Henry Parish. As Parish enters the room, he reveals what he had witnessed in the previous night’s dream. In the dream, Moloch was standing in the forest, surrounded by the four white trees like those seen by the Mills sisters and he […]